Output fe6ab723e5dfb14b59c2553107a96e836c6a47024f033ac15aea9f7571645d2a:1

value
102740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a49073e36b4c26161efb92ebf18ab31b57933eb OP_EQUAL
address
A53TPxTvFLRDBquv83t1ezCSdsX41p1zL4
transaction
fe6ab723e5dfb14b59c2553107a96e836c6a47024f033ac15aea9f7571645d2a